  • When Dogs Guard People: Resource Guarding a Pet Parent
    Apr 29 2026

    Text Me Your Questions

    In this episode of Dog Training Today, Dog Behaviorist Will Bangura explains one of the most misunderstood forms of resource guarding: when a dog guards access to a pet parent, family member, couch, bed, lap, or preferred person.

    Many pet parents describe this behavior as jealousy, protectiveness, or loyalty. However, when a dog stiffens, blocks, growls, snaps, lunges, or bites as another dog, spouse, child, visitor, or family member approaches, the behavior may be better understood as resource guarding.

    Will breaks down what person-directed resource guarding looks like, why it happens, why punishment can increase risk, and how pet parents can begin managing the behavior safely. He also explains the importance of distance, early body language, threshold awareness, pain and medical considerations, multi-dog household management, and humane behavior modification.

    This episode is especially important for families living with multiple dogs, dogs who guard the couch or bed, dogs who growl when another dog approaches a pet parent, and dogs who become tense or aggressive when people come too close to a valued person.

    Learn why growling should not be punished, why dogs should not be forced to “work it out,” and why the goal is not forced sharing. The goal is safety, emotional change, predictable routines, and helping the dog learn that people and dogs approaching the pet parent are not a threat.

  • Balanced Training Myths - Positive Reinforcement Truths
    Oct 6 2025

    Text Me Your Questions

    We break down the “balanced training” myth and explain why corrections suppress behavior without teaching, while force-free methods build reliable habits by changing a dog’s emotional state. We share science, real-world steps, and how to find a qualified pro.

    • positive reinforcement as a full behavioral system
    • why aversives suppress rather than teach
    • fear and perceived threat as roots of reactivity and aggression
    • counterconditioning and desensitization under threshold
    • extinction and differential reinforcement for durable change
    • signs of shutdown vs true calm
    • how to vet trainers and certifications
    • ethics, welfare, and the bond with your dog
